Understanding Life Habits That Affect Marital Desire

As couples spend more time together, certain negative habits can significantly affect their passion and intimacy. What are these life habits that can dampen marital desire? Let's explore the truth behind this issue.

1. Sleep Deprivation

The Centers for Disease Control (CDC) identifies sleep deprivation as a major public health epidemic. A study published in a UK journal revealed that insufficient sleep not only leads to fatigue but also negatively impacts sexual desire in both men and women. It is recommended that individuals aim for 7 to 9 hours of sleep each night, ensuring that 5 to 7 hours of this is deep sleep.

2. Neglecting Physical Fitness

Good sexual performance relies heavily on aerobic capacity, endurance, strength, and flexibility. According to Dr. Nicole Praus, a sex expert at UCLA, regular exercise boosts heart rate and blood circulation, which enhances sexual function. A daily regimen, such as walking for 30 minutes or practicing yoga, can greatly improve one’s sexual life.

3. Bringing Work into the Bedroom

Experts suggest that the bedroom should serve as a sanctuary for sleep and intimacy. Engaging in other activities in this space leads to distractions that not only disrupt sleep quality but can also harm marital relations. It's advised to avoid working in the bedroom, keeping the environment tidy, warm, and free from electronic distractions like computers and TVs.

4. Dietary Deficiencies

A balanced diet is crucial for maintaining sexual health, as vitamins and trace elements are closely linked to sexual function. Zinc is particularly important for male health, with oysters being an excellent source. Foods rich in B vitamins, such as salmon, chicken, and tuna, help boost energy levels and enhance blood flow, positively influencing sexual performance.

5. Consumption of Gas-Inducing Foods

While there is no conclusive research linking gas-inducing foods like beans and broccoli directly to diminished sexual satisfaction, these foods can lead to physical discomfort that may affect intimacy. If a couple has plans for a romantic evening, it might be best to avoid such foods.

6. Excessive Alcohol Intake

Research indicates that overindulgence in alcohol can hinder sexual climax. Chronic alcohol consumption can lead to lasting damage to sexual function. While a moderate amount of alcohol may enhance desire—especially in women—excess is detrimental. Experts suggest limiting intake to avoid negative impacts.

7. Smoking

According to the Mayo Clinic, smoking disrupts blood flow, leading to inadequate blood supply to the heart and sexual organs, which significantly affects sexual quality. Numerous studies have linked smoking to erectile dysfunction. Those who smoke are encouraged to reduce their intake or seek help from professionals to quit.

8. Medication Impact

Though the FDA does not monitor the sexual side effects of medications, studies reveal that around 70% of drugs can prevent individuals from reaching climax. Antidepressants and antihypertensives are known to lower sexual desire, while some antihistamines may cause vaginal dryness in women. If medication is suspected to be affecting sexual life negatively, discussing alternatives with a healthcare provider is crucial.

9. Hesitance to Masturbate

Many view masturbation as a negative habit of youth, yet sexual experts argue that it can address sexual dysfunction. Masturbation can enhance sexual pleasure and help individuals understand their sexual preferences, thus also igniting desire for their partners. Couples might consider integrating it as a healthy part of their foreplay.
